Synopsis

The sun is out. The temperature is hot. And Sasha has everything packed and ready for a full day of swimming! But Mr. Sloth is taking for-eh-ver! Sasha does NOT like to wait. However, her best friend is never in a hurry. Will Sasha learn to be patient, or will her quick temper ruin a memorable summer outing? Showcasing the unlikely duo of an energetic girl and a sloth, Waiting on Mr. Sloth is a story about patience and its importance.

About Katy Hudson

Katy Hudson is an author and illustrator of critically acclaimed and bestselling children’s books, including Bear and Duck, Too Many Carrots, and A Loud Winter's Nap. She won the Oppenheim Toy Portfolio Best Book Award Gold in 2014 for her illustrations in the book Animal Teachers. She lives in London.

About Erin Ruth Walker

Erin Ruth Walker graduated with a bachelor's degree in acting from Boston University and went on to perform in film, television, and theater. She enjoys lending her voice to multiple genres, including young adult, thriller, and fantasy.
